The ingredients needed to make Halloumi Cheese & Chorizo Salad:
  1. Take pack Halloumi cheese
  2. Make ready Chorizo
  3. Make ready Lettuce
  4. Take Fresh mushrooms
  5. Prepare Tomato
  6. Take Garlic
  7. Prepare ☆ Whole grain mustard
  8. Make ready ☆ Honey
  9. Prepare ☆ White wine vinegar
  10. Prepare ☆ Lemon juice
  11. Prepare ☆ Dried basil (or dried parsley etc.)

Halloumi is a Cypriot firm, brined, slightly springy white cheese, traditionally made from a mixture of goat and sheep milk, although these days cow's milk is also used. Its texture is similar to that of mozzarella or thick feta, except that it has a strong, salty flavour imbibed from the brine preserve. Steps to make Halloumi Cheese & Chorizo Salad:
  1. Chop up the vegetables and arrange them on a plate.
  2. This is the halloumi cheese that I used this time.
  3. Cut up the cheese, chorizo, and garlic. The cheese is easier to cook if it isn't sliced too thinly. Maybe around 8 mm is good.
  4. Sauté the garlic in a frying pan with some olive oil. When the garlic starts to sizzle, add in the chorizo. When the chorizo has cooked too, add it to the plate with the salad.
  5. Leave the oil from the chorizo in the pan and cook the cheese on both sides until browned. Turn the slices of cheese over one at a time and handle them gently.
  6. While the cheese is cooking, prepare the dressing. Mix together all of the ☆ ingredients.
  7. When the cheese has cooked, add it to the top of the salad, pour the dressing over the top and serve while hot.

It's most appreciated as a grilling cheese because it maintains its shape when heated and grills well. Halloumi is moderately high in fat and a good source of protein. Halloumi cheese is made by hand from a mix of sheep's and goat's milk. The milk is produced in the villages surrounding the Avdhimou area between Limassol and Paphos districts. The soft, springy, oval-shaped curd resembles a fresh mozzarella and has a mild yet tangy flavor.
